Transaction 5126572de369dc6feb47431409667973b1c325a9a4bf01ae069da69a927c94e8

4 Input
2 Outputs
  • 5126572de369dc6feb47431409667973b1c325a9a4bf01ae069da69a927c94e8:0
  • value  362209
    address  3FTJkj9RgpDLSYskP2RNDgfyh11o3eVDVo
  • 5126572de369dc6feb47431409667973b1c325a9a4bf01ae069da69a927c94e8:1
  • value  1378332
    address  bc1qs6k0rgp6jnfsuaur7dsgmnz2h227nfx0j8twdc